2. How to Disable Windows 10 Update Through the Control Panel
The first tip to permanently turn off Windows 10 updates is through the Control Panel. This step is very easy to do, here’s how to disable Windows 10 updates via the control panel:
- Open Control Panel by typing “Control Panel” in the search field on the side Start Menu.
- Then, choose System and Security and press menu Administrative Tools.
- A new page will appear containing various features with different functions. Here, you choose Services just.
- Scroll down until you find Windows Update, and double-click it. Page appears Windows Update Properties.
- Now, toggle the option on Startup Type Becomes Disabledand click the button Stop on Service Status. Then press Ok.
If you want to turn on the Windows 10 update, just roll back the settings to factory default.

3. How to turn off Windows 10 Auto Update via Metered Connection
This method applies to those of you who use a WiFi network. Here’s how to stop Windows 10 auto updates using Metered Connection:
- Right-click on the WiFi name that is already connected, and select it Properties.
- Then, scroll down. Activate toggle to position ON on Set as metered connection.
4. How to Turn Off Windows 10 Automatic Updates Through Configure Automatic Updates
The following method of turning off automatic Windows 10 updates only applies to the Professional, Enterprise and Education versions. Here’s how:
- Press a key on the keyboard Windows + Rand type gpedit.msc. Then press the button Enter.
- Then, choose Computer Configuration and click Administrative Templates.
- Enter to Windows Componentsand select a menu Windows Update.
- Next press twice Configure Automatic Updates. To turn off updates, select Disabled and click OK.
- If you want to turn on the update as before, just change the setting to Enabled.
- You can also disable Windows 10 OS driver updates only by going to the section Do not include drivers with Windows update at the same location.
- Double-click the setting, change the options to Enabled and click Ok.
- If you want to allow driver updates, just change the setting to Not Configured.

5. How to turn off Windows 10 updates via Regedit
How to permanently turn off Windows 10 updates next via regedit. This last tip is quite difficult to follow, so pay attention!
- type regedit in the search field on the side Start Menu.
- If so, access the regedit menu H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E > SOFTWARE > Policies > Microsoft > Windows.
- Right click on Windowsand select New > Key.
- Enter WindowsUpdate as the name.
- Next, right click on the key, and click New > Key. Name the key as AU.
- Click key AU. On the right side, right click and press Newselect DWORD (32-bit) Value.
- Finally, give it a name NoAutoUpdate. Double click on that key, and fill in the value with 0 to enable automatic updates and 1 to turn it off. Then press OK.

7. How to Turn off Windows 10 Automatic Updates via CMD
You can also permanently disable Windows 10 updates by using a command executed via CMD or command prompt. Here’s how:
- type CMD in the search field on the Start Menu. You can also press the button Windows + R and type CMDthen press Ok or Enter to open it.
- Then, run the command net stop wuauserv, net stop bitsand net stop dosvc sequentially.
- Close CMD, Windows 10 updates will automatically stop.
- To continue the update, you do the same method alternately.
